UG-SAFE

The UG-SAFE fire announcement system is a specialized fire protection solution for mining belt conveyors. It enhances fire safety and protects lives and property in mining operations.

Key features of the UG-SAFE system:

  1. Fire Detection: Utilizes advanced sensors and algorithms to accurately identify fire or smoke along mining belt conveyors.
  2. Alarm Notification: Triggers audible and visual alarms promptly upon detecting a fire, alerting personnel nearby for immediate action and evacuation.
  3. Communication System: Equipped with a robust infrastructure to transmit fire alarms and notifications to control centers, command stations, or designated personnel, enabling swift emergency response coordination.
  4. Integration: Seamlessly integrates with other fire protection and monitoring systems in mining operations, allowing centralized control, monitoring, and coordination.
  5. Monitoring and Control: Provides real-time monitoring and control capabilities, enabling operators to promptly respond to detected incidents. Remote access and control features may be available.
  6. Compliance: Engineered to meet specific fire safety standards for mining operations, ensuring the highest level of safety and protection.

By integrating advanced fire detection technology and effective communication capabilities, the UG-SAFE system aims to enhance the safety of mining belt conveyors and prevent fire incidents from escalating. Its implementation as a supplementary system to ELSAP-SAFE further strengthens the overall fire protection measures in place

ELSAP-SAFE

The ELSAP-SAFE intrinsically safe fire protection system developed by Kazcentrmontazh plays a key role in fire protection of belt conveyors for the mining industry.

This innovative system focuses on robust fire detection and prevention. By vigilantly monitoring critical operational parameters of the conveyor system, the ELSAP-SAFE system aims to ensure the security and safety of mining operations.

 

If a fire is detected inside the conveyor system, the ELSAP-SAFE intrinsically safe fire protection system is immediately activated. It employs a variety of suppression mechanisms to swiftly contain the fire’s spread and minimize its impact, tailored to the unique requirements of the conveyor system and the materials being transported.

 

The ELSAP-SAFE system stands as a comprehensive fire protection solution, custom-designed for belt conveyors used in mining operations. With its sophisticated fire detection technologies and personalized design approach, it is a dependable choice for enhancing the safety and security of mining belt conveyor systems.

APPLICATION

The SAFE type system for automatic fire extinguishing of conveyor belt fires allows for instantaneous self-extinguishing of an existing fire, as well as automatic generation of alarms and warns the operator of the danger. It can be used in underground mines in areas with explosion hazard, with “a” or “b” methane explosion hazard, as well as category A and B coal dust explosion hazard.

System Description.

The system for automatic fire extinguishing on SAFE type belt conveyors consists of the following units:

  1. intrinsically safe controller,
  2. shut-off valve with pressure sensor,
  3. a starting unit with temperature sensors and a passage valve,
  4. fire extinguishing unit,
  5. loudspeaker alarms

 

The principle of the system.

As a result of increasing temperature (above the set temperature) of the conveyor elements as well as the environment, the temperature sensors are triggered, i.e. the low-melting alloy connecting the nut to the plate starts to melt at a temperature of 75°С.

This action automatically starts the water sprinklers.

A drop in water pressure in the pipelines is detected by a pressure sensor, which transmits information about the fire extinguishing system activation to the ELSAP SAFE intrinsically safe system controller.

The controller causes an instantaneous stop of the conveyor drives and transmits an alarm signal to the UG SAFE signaling devices located along the conveyor route, and automatically informs the dispatcher about the emergency situation.
